    A combiner box is a key DC distribution device used between PV strings and the inverter. Each string consists of solar modules wired in series, and the combiner box gathers multiple strings into a single output while ensuring safety and system efficiency.     The working principle of combiner boxes is simple – they combine the DC output of multiple solar panels into a manageable circuit. This device plays a significant role in both residential and commercial solar installations, particularly when. Many solar installations use a combiner box for safety, efficiency, and neatness. String inputs: Each string connects through a fuse holder or breaker. This protects against reverse currents from parallel strings.

    Lightning protection: Lightning protection of photovoltaic combiner boxes is achieved through surge protection Module (SPD). The core logic is to discharge lightning energy quickly to prevent equipment from being damaged by overvoltage. Its ease of installation and deployment usually determines an ideal combiner. It.
